def get_pagination_info(total: int, page: int, per_page: int) -> dict:
"""Calculate pagination information.
Args:
total: Total number of items
page: Current page number
per_page: Items per page
Returns:
Dictionary with pagination details
"""
total_pages = (total + per_page - 1) // per_page if total > 0 else 1
return {
'total': total,
'page': page,
'per_page': per_page,
'has_next': page < total_pages,
'has_prev': page > 1,
'next_num': page + 1 if page < total_pages else None,
'prev_num': page - 1 if page > 1 else None,
'pages': total_pages
}

@app.route('/rss')
def rss_feed():
"""RSS 2.0 endpoint for latest archived articles."""
limit = request.args.get('limit', 50, type=int)
articles = get_latest_articles(limit=limit)
server_url = f'http://192.168.8.150:5000'
rss_items = []
for article in articles:
if article.title and article.content_text and 'Performing security verification' not in article.content_text:
pub_date = None
if article.publish_date:
try:
dt = datetime.fromisoformat(article.publish_date.replace('Z', '+00:00'))
pub_date = dt.strftime('%a, %d %b %Y %H:%M:%S %z').strip()
except (ValueError, AttributeError):
try:
dt = datetime.fromisoformat(article.publish_date)
pub_date = dt.strftime('%a, %d %b %Y %H:%M:%S +0000')
except (ValueError, AttributeError):
pub_date = datetime.now(timezone.utc).strftime('%a, %d %b %Y %H:%M:%S +0000')
source_name = article.source_name or 'unknown'
encoded_source = quote(source_name.lower())
item = {
'title': article.title,
'link': f'{server_url}/source/{encoded_source}/article/{article.id}',
'pubDate': pub_date,
'description': article.content_text[:500] if article.content_text else '',
'guid': article.url or f'article-{article.id}'
}
if article.author:
item['author'] = article.author
rss_items.append(item)
rss_template = render_template(
'rss.xml',
title='NewsArchiver - Latest Articles',
link=server_url,
description='Latest archived news articles',
last_build_date=datetime.now(timezone.utc).strftime('%a, %d %b %Y %H:%M:%S +0000'),
items=rss_items
)
response = make_response(rss_template)
response.headers['Content-Type'] = 'application/rss+xml; charset=utf-8'
return response
